Srinagar, July 31 -- The Government of Jammu & Kashmir has approved two major heritage conservation projects worthRs.13.75 crore for the restoration and revival of the historic heritage site of Purmandal in Samba and the conservation and upgradation of the historic Imambara Zadibal in Srinagar. The twin initiatives reaffirm the Government's commitment to preserving Jammu & Kashmir's rich religious, cultural and architectural heritage while enhancing facilities for pilgrims, devotees and visitors. The Government has approved aRs.7.16 crore project for the restoration and revival of the historic heritage site of Purmandal in Samba.
